He reflects on changes in the music industry as "impresario type" producers and small independent labels have been swallowed up, talks about the nature of his creative collaboration with artists in the studio and how personal connections & recommendations helped build lasting partnerships. He's very deferential and gracious: "My job is to facilitate the artists."

Very worth listening to.

I loved an early bit when he recounted flying in to London from LA, going to (Abbey Road) to help The Beatles, then off to (Olympic) to help The Stones on "Let It Bleed" finally moving on to record Jimi playing live!

Not bad for a day's work!
